The Witcher: Sirens of the Deep Animated Film Gets Release Date

September 18, 2024 by Carley Garcia

The voices will sound familiar.

First announced in 2021, The Witcher: Sirens of the Deep is an upcoming animated fantasy drama film set in The Witcher universe. Fans have been eager for an update, and Netflix has responded, announcing that the movie will be released on the streaming service on February 11, 2025.

This will be the second animated feature film inspired by the popular book and game series, following The Witcher: Nightmare of the Wolf released in August 2021.

The Witcher: Sirens of the Deep will reportedly take place between the fifth and sixth episodes of the first season of the live-action Witcher Netflix series.

Doug Cockle, the voice of Geralt in The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t, will reprise his role. Joey Batey, who played Jaskier in the live-action series, will also star, along with his co-star Anya Chalotra as Yennefer of Vengerberg.

The film is based on A Little Sacrifice, a short story penned by the creator of the Witcher universe, Andrzej Sapkowki. Unsurprisingly, it involves Geralt “hired to investigate a series of attacks in a seaside village, finding himself drawn into a centuries-old conflict between humans and merpeople.” 

Released in 2015, The Witcher 3 has sold over 50 million copies, making it one of the best-selling video games ever. It holds over 200 game of the year awards, also taking home trophies for Excellence in Technical Achievement, Excellence in Visual Achievement, and Excellence in Narrative at the 2016 SXSW Gaming Awards. The game is available on PC, PlayStation 4, PlayStation 5, Xbox One, Xbox Series X/S, and Nintendo Switch.
